The SDGs are the United Nations' 17 Sustainable Development Goals. They form a global framework for progress through 2030 across poverty, health, education, equality, energy, work, infrastructure, climate, ecosystems, peace, partnerships, and other connected social, economic, and environmental priorities.

Why not others:
- COP21 was the 2015 UN climate conference associated with the Paris Agreement

- UNESCO is the UN agency for education, science, and culture

- WHO is the World Health Organization

Key rule: SDGs names the set of 17 global goals; COP21 is a conference, while UNESCO and WHO are international organizations.
